I am currently on one, but that's Silversurfers which also shares with Saga Connections .
Another one also has multiple dating sites such Older Dating and Yours dating .
Both are run by separate set ups the first by the Dating Lab ,and the second set by another
Doing the local to me search some also appear on Match .com
You could respond to someone who is on entirely different one, then that is when the subscription thing steps you could get bogus messages as well.
